ALABASTER – Those looking to get more serious about the country’s fastest-growing sport now have the chance to thanks to the new Alabaster Pickleball Club.

Registration is open for the city of Alabaster’s new pickleball league which will be hosted through the Alabaster Pickleball Club on the Pickleplay app.

“Since pickleball has grown so much in the area in the past few years, and now that we have 14 courts… we wanted to offer something that would allow (locals) to be able to play against people of their own abilities in more of a competitive setting,” Alabaster Parks and Recreation Director Tim Hamm said. “Our plan is to offer the league within the club and give rewards out and things like that.”

The city of Alabaster currently offers 14 total pickleball courts for residents to take advantage of with eight located at Veterans Park and six at Patriots Park. Members of the Alabaster Pickleball Club will receive a T-shirt for joining and will be able to reserve courts on Tuesdays and Thursdays from 6-9 p.m. and on Saturdays from 8 a.m. to noon through the Pickleplay app.

“Within those preferred times, we plan to offer types of leagues depending on our registration,” Hamm said.

The Alabaster Pickleball Club currently plans on offering singles, men’s double, women’s double and mixed double divisions. According to Hamm, depending on the number of players and interest from the community, the city plans on rotating between the courts at Veterans Park and Patriots Park.

Hamm said the city was inspired to offer the new opportunity by similar efforts in local municipalities.

“We’ve talked to people over in Trussville, we’ve talked to people down in Auburn (and) we’ve looked at numerous different pickleball leagues online to try to gather up all different ideas,” Hamm said. “And as we see need for certain things that we’re not offering, we’ll be able to look at that and implement those as we see what best fits our community.”

The Alabaster Pickleball Club is available for individuals age 16 and older. Each participant has to have their own account in the Pickleplay app in order to join the club. Registration for the club is $30 annually and includes a T-shirt.
